Crawlspace Water Restoration in Phoenix, AZ
Crawlspace water restoration services focus on removing excess moisture and addressing water intrusion issues within a property's crawlspace area. These projects typically involve extracting standing water, drying out affected surfaces, and implementing measures to prevent future moisture problems. Homeowners may request this service after experiencing flooding, plumbing leaks, or persistent dampness that can lead to mold growth, wood rot, or structural damage if left unaddressed. Understanding the extent of water intrusion and the source of the moisture are important considerations before initiating restoration work.
Property owners should be aware that crawlspace water restoration often includes cleaning and sanitizing affected areas, as well as inspecting for potential damage caused by water exposure. Proper assessment helps determine whether additional repairs or moisture control solutions, such as sealing or installing vapor barriers, are necessary to protect the home’s foundation and indoor air quality. Clear communication about the scope of work and any underlying issues can ensure that the restoration process effectively restores a safe, dry environment beneath the property.

Crawlspace Water Restoration Questions
What causes water issues in a crawlspace? Water can enter due to leaks, poor drainage, or high humidity, leading to moisture buildup and potential damage.
How can water damage in a crawlspace be prevented? Proper drainage, vapor barriers, and sealing entry points help reduce water intrusion and moisture problems.
What signs indicate water problems in a crawlspace? Signs include standing water, mold growth, musty odors, and wood rot around the area.
What is involved in restoring a water-damaged crawlspace? Restoration typically includes removing standing water, drying the area, and addressing sources of moisture to prevent future issues.
